I've been using the 2i2 for a few years, it's performed very well.

Only issue is that it clips fairly easily, so if you're trying to go direct with a particularly high output guitar or bass, you might have to wind the gain down a fair bit to compensate.

I'd advise getting an interface with MIDI ports on it, so that you can connect the DX7 with MIDI and audio. That way you can use it to trigger other sounds (ie use it as a MIDI controller keyboard), plus you can record the performance, and then tweak the patches before recording the sounds back in (ie use it as a sound module).
